Posted: June 23rd, 2010 | Author: stacey | Filed under: Fashion & Beauty, Friends & Family | Tags: apothecary, men's grooming | No Comments »Speaking of Father’s Day, my father, who I call Da, has an extensive collection of barber and old apothecary items. This is specifically handed down from my father’s grandfather, Willis, who was a barber, to my father, then to me. Well, sort of. I don’t want to be a barber nor so I practice cutting my husband’s beard, but I do have an affinity for apothecary treasures and shinny smooth pearl handles, board hair brushes, and porcelain jars. I attribute my fascination with grooming products to my father, who always let me discover the little treasures in our curiosity cabinet. I’m fond of this photo above, as it reminds me of the little pharmacies in Barcelona, Spain.
I love this article in the NY Times T Magazine about Old-Style Apothecary, MiN, and others in the Big Apple.
“The world doesn’t need more products, just better ones,” says Chad Murawczyk, who opened MiN New York, an old-style apothecary, on one of SoHo’s few remaining gritty stretches six months ago.
